braṣṭa-

Khotanese

Etymology

From Proto-Iranian *pṛs-, pṛšta-, Proto-Indo-European *perḱ-, pṛḱ-sḱ-. Cognate to Sanskrit praś-, pṛcchati, pṛṣta-.

Verb

braṣṭa-

  1. asked, past participle of puls-.
    • 1951, H. W. Bailey, Khotanese Buddhist Texts, Tailor's Foreign Press, 45·19:
      ttī-t-ī hā brraṣṭā sa
      ‘then she asked him’
    • 1956, H. W. Bailey, Khotanese Texts III, Cambridge at the University Press, 129·16:
      drūnā parīdą brrīṣṭi
      ‘they deign to ask the health’
